Lincoln RelatedBold Abraham Lincoln Carte de Visite Image By Brady
1861, Carte de Visite with Photographic Image of Abraham Lincoln, from a negative in Brady's National Portrait Gallery, Published by E. Anthony, 0-49c, 50 Broadway, New York, Extremely Fine.
This well familiar Carte de Visite shows the full-length seated pose with Lincoln facing right. Taken by Brady on Feb. 24, 1861, with backstamp from publisher E. Anthony. A clean bold image with nice contrast.
